Moon snails drill a hole in the shell of clams and suck them out. If you walk the beach you will find clam shells with small round holes drilled in them near the hinge. That is the work of a moon snail.

What kinds of food should you eat on the moon?

On the moon, astronauts eat dehydrated and prepackaged foods due to the lack of refrigeration and cooking facilities. These foods are lightweight and have a long shelf life. They typically consist of freeze-dried fruits, vegetables, meats, and shelf-stable snacks. Rehydrating these foods with water allows astronauts to have a variety of meals while in space.

Who was the first astronaut to eat turkey on the moon?

No astronaut has ever eaten turkey on the moon. The first humans to walk on the moon were part of NASA's Apollo missions, and their food consisted of specially designed freeze-dried meals.
